PPD: Man solicited teen through parent

PENSACOLA, Fla. (WALA) - Pensacola police said they arrested a Fort Walton Beach man after he drove to Pensacola under the impression he was going to have sexual relations with a 13-year-old girl.

Police arrested Joshua Baker, 22, Friday night on charges of using a computer to solicit parent guardian consent, traveling to meet using a computer to solicit parent or guardian and using a two way communication device to facilitate a felony.

Police said Baker began talking to PPD detective Jeff Brown over the internet on Tuesday Feb. 26. They said the suspect thought he was arranging to have sex with Brown’s daughter.

The detective organized a meeting with Brown the night of Friday, March 1.

When Baker arrived around 7 p.m. on Friday, police said they arrested him.
